Masterfully small oil portrait of a young lady was executed  in 1850 by listed Austrian portrait painter Karl (Carl) Vogl (born in Vienna in 1820). The son of a painter, he followed his father's career, but in a nobler direction, by entering the Imperial and Royal Academy of Fine Arts in July 1833, where he trained as a portrait painter. At the annual exhibition of this institute in 1841, he appeared before the public for the first time with two portraits painted in oil; then again in that of 1844. After that, his portraits are no longer seen in exhibitions. In the years mentioned, the artist had his studio in the new building at no. 230. - In 1856, a portrait painter named Karl Vogel lived in Gratz, whose numerous individual portraits and family paintings were praised for the fineness and purity of the brush, for the liveliness and delicate nuances even in the smallest details, but also for the verve in the staffage and draping. 

Literature: lexicons by H.Fuchs; Thieme/Becker; Saur; Admission protocols of the Imperial and Royal Academy of Fine Arts in Vienna. – Admission protocols of the Imperial and Royal Academy of Fine Arts in Vienna. – Catalogues of the annual exhibitions of the Imperial and Royal Academy of Fine Arts at St. Anna in Vienna (8°.) 1841, p. 12, no. 67 and 73 and year 1844, p. 9, no. 24. – Gratzer Telegraph (political paper) 1856, no. 46: “Native Art”.

Inscription : signed and dated 1850 , vertical lower right.

Technique: oil on cardboard, original period frame.

Measurements: unframed w 5 1/8" x h 6" (13 x 15,3 cm), framed 8" x 8 7/8" (20,5 x 22,5 cm).

Condition: very good.
